What is mitosis?
|
somatic cell division; nuclear division which the duplicated chromosomes separate to form two genetically identical daughter cells
|
|
What is Meiosis?
|
reductive division that converts a diploid cell into 4 haploid cells, each with one complete set of chromosomes
|
|
Define Haploid
|
having only one set of chromosomes (n) in contrast to diploid (2n)
|
|
Define Diploid
|
having two sets of chromosomes (2n); in animals, twice the number characteristic of gametes; in plants, the chromosome number characteristic of the sporophyte generation; in contrast to haploid (n)
|
|
Define Chromosome
|
vehicle by which heredity information is physically transmitted from one generation to the next
|
|
Define Chromatin
|
complex DNA and proteins of which eukaryotic chromosomes are composed; chromatin is highly uncoiled and diffuse in interphase nucei, condensing to form the visible chromosomes in prophase
|
|
Define Chromatids
|
one of the two daughter strand of a duplicated chromosome that is joined by a single centromere
|
|
Define Homologous Pairs
|
pair of the same kind of chromosome in a diploid cell
|
|
Define DNA Replication
|
semiconservative resulting in two identical DNA molecules, each of which is composed of one original strand and one new strand
|
|
Define Cell Division (Cytokinesis)
|
division of the cytoplasm of a cell after nuclear division
|
|
Define Independent Assortment
|
in a dihybrid cross, describes the random assortment of alleles for each of the genes. For genes on different chromosomes this results from the random orientations of different homologous pairs during metaphase I of meiosis. For genes on the same chromosome, this occurs when the two loci are far enough apart for roughly equal numbers of odd- and even- numbered multiple crossover events
|
|
Define crossing over
|
in meiosis, the exchange of corresponding chromatid segments between homologous chromosomes; responsible for genetic recombination between homologous chromosomes
